Abram Lincoln Harris, Jr. (January 17, 1899 – November 6, 1963) was an American economist, academic, anthropologist and a social critic of the condition of blacks in the United States. [1] Considered by many as the first African American to achieve prominence in the field of economics, Harris was also known for his heavy influence on black ...

[1]The Abram Lincoln Harris Papers consist of 29 items and span the period 1919-1929. These papers were developed from Harris' research on the involvement of Negroes in the American Labor Movement, particularly in the Industrial Workers of the World (I.W.W.). Most of its land is under basin irrigation, yielding only. when is the next starlight festival in prodigy 2023 Abram Lincoln Harris Jr. was from Richmond, Virginia. He made impressive strides in various specialized economic areas, anthropology, and Black studies.
